Ticket #4417 — CrumbWorks staging misconfiguration. The order-cutoff rule for Pellman's Bakehouse was firing at 02:00 instead of 14:00 because staging loaded the production cutoff config. Root cause: the env file for the cutoff-scheduler service was copied without updating region overrides. Fix requires regenerating the scheduler's signing credential before redeploy. The corrected env file must include the following line:

sealed setting: VAULT_KEY20=39d48de497b3678643bc

Subject: Order cutoff now enforced in Ovenpath

Hi all — starting this release, Ovenpath rejects bakery orders placed after the 3 p.m. cutoff instead of silently queuing them for the same day. New folks: this is expected behavior, not a bug, so don't reopen tickets about it. Customers see a clear message with the next available date. The release token appears below.

pipeline stamp: htk9_ce63042d9

Quarterly Planning Note — Cash-Flow Forecast

Heads of department: quick summary ahead of Monday. Pellwood Fabrics expects a tighter Q3, with inflows lagging the Marnell contract payments by about six weeks. Keep discretionary spend light until October. Full model lands next week. The strategic context sits in the confidential note below.

board note of kafog-bajep: Briathek Partners is in early talks to buy Aldaelek Group for about $47.1 million. The Ulaath launch date is September 4, and nothing goes to the press before then.